9、2-4 : 1988 (E) Wrought aluminium and aluminium alloy extruded rods/bars, tubes and profiles - Part 4 : Extruded profiles - Tolerances 1 Scope and field of application This part of IS0 6362 specifies the tolerances on shape and dimensions of extruded profiles of wrought aluminium and aluminium alloys

10、 with cross-sectional dimensions given by a circumscribing circle not greater than 600 mm. The shape of the cross-section is based on a drawing agreed upon by the purchaser and the supplier. Straightness in the longitudinal direction shall be measured by placing the profile on a flat table, the profile resting under its own weight. It

34、 shall be specified for the total length I, as well as for any segment of 300 mm (see figure 5). 3.1.3 Squareness of cut ends The deviation from squareness of cut ends shall not exceed 0,017 mm/mm width (equivalent to a lo angle). For profiles ordered as fixed lengths, this deviation shall be includ

35、ed in the fixed-length tolerances (table 2). The deviation h, from straightness for the length shall not exceed 2 mm/m length. Local deviation h, from straightness shall not exceed 0,6 mm/300 mm length. Straightness tolerances for tempers TX510 shall be subject to agreement between purchaser and sup
